    Re: Media Center Stopped Working

    Actual product support might. The Media Center code is quite different than
    other Windows code, and so it's generally not going to be possible to get
    help on crashes/"stopped working" issues with *Media Center* here. I would
    be pretty to extremely impressed if anybody was able to help based upon
    *Media Center* fault data. If the Media Center crash starts impacting WMP
    or DVDMaker or other Windows multimedia code, *that* might be possible to
    deal with within the context of those other applications, but dealing with a
    Media Center crash by itself in my eyes would probably require the DMP file
    or something else super-concrete to work with. The abstract fault data that
    might be useful for other areas is not useful for Media Center, sorry. =\
